A well-established civil engineering firm is seeking a Senior Quantity Surveyor based around Gloucester / Worcester / Birmingham. This role involves working on heavy civil projects including flood alleviation and highways works.
The ideal candidate will possess strong communication and problem-solving skills, have experience with NEC contracts, and a full UK driving licence.
The company offers a competitive salary of up to £65k, a car allowance, 25 days holiday, and a pension scheme.

How to prepare for a job interview at Linsco Ltd.
✨Know Your NEC Contracts
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of NEC contracts before the interview. Be ready to discuss your experience with them and how you've successfully managed projects using these contracts in the past.
✨Showcase Your Problem-Solving Skills
Prepare examples of challenges you've faced in previous roles, particularly in heavy civil projects. Highlight how you approached these problems and the solutions you implemented, as this will demonstrate your critical thinking abilities.
✨Communicate Clearly and Confidently
Strong communication is key for a Senior Quantity Surveyor. Pract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. Consider doing mock interviews with a friend to refine your delivery and ensure you can convey your ideas effectively.
✨Understand the Company and Its Projects
Research the firm and its recent projects, especially those related to flood alleviation and highways works. This will not only show your interest in the role but also allow you to ask insightful questions during the interview.
